Commit 9b11d639 authored by Andy Shevchenko's avatar Andy Shevchenko Committed by Miguel Ojeda
Browse files

auxdisplay: panel: Convert to use charlcd_free()



Convert to use charlcd_free() instead of kfree() for sake of type check.

Reviewed-by: default avatarGeert Uytterhoeven <geert+renesas@glider.be>
Signed-off-by: default avatarAndy Shevchenko <andriy.shevchenko@linux.intel.com>
Signed-off-by: default avatarMiguel Ojeda <miguel.ojeda.sandonis@gmail.com>
parent 8e44fc85
Loading
Loading
Loading
Loading
+2 −2
Original line number Diff line number Diff line
@@ -1620,7 +1620,7 @@ err_lcd_unreg:
	if (lcd.enabled)
		charlcd_unregister(lcd.charlcd);
err_unreg_device:
	kfree(lcd.charlcd);
	charlcd_free(lcd.charlcd);
	lcd.charlcd = NULL;
	parport_unregister_device(pprt);
	pprt = NULL;
@@ -1647,7 +1647,7 @@ static void panel_detach(struct parport *port)
	if (lcd.enabled) {
		charlcd_unregister(lcd.charlcd);
		lcd.initialized = false;
		kfree(lcd.charlcd);
		charlcd_free(lcd.charlcd);
		lcd.charlcd = NULL;
	}